Applications
10-Undecenyl 4-hydroxybenzoate (CAS 97861-82-0) is an ester of p-hydroxybenzoic acid with an unsaturated long-chain alcohol, and its undec-ene group can participate in radical polymerization, making it a potential monomer or functional additive for polymer and coating systems, especially UV-curable coatings and polymerizable inks; it can serve as an intermediate in the synthesis of specialty polymers and in adhesive formulations to impart aromatic functionality and crosslinking capability; in cosmetics/personal care, hydroxybenzoate esters are commonly evaluated as preservative-type ingredients or fragrance components, and this compound may be considered for similar roles subject to regulatory limits; in industrial manufacturing, it can be used to introduce aryl functionality and crosslinkable alkenes into materials, supporting advanced coatings and composites; use is subject to local regulations and formulation limits.
